## Getting started with `picshrink`

The `picshrink` CLI handles all batch image resizing for the Moorgate asset pipeline. Clone the tools repo, run the bootstrap script, and confirm `picshrink --version` reports 3.x. Jobs submitted to the shared render farm must be signed or they'll sit unpicked in the queue. For contractor accounts, sign with the key provided below.

signing key of bagap-yawep = bky13_TbfT6ZMUoGJo2

**Internal Memo — Bramleigh Licensing Dispute**

Board members: quick update on the tangle with Bramleigh Systems over the Softquill renderer license. Their counsel claims our Everpine build exceeds seat limits; ours disagrees. Talks resume next week, and Counsel Irena Voss is cautiously optimistic. Rather than email the strategy around, we've placed the confidential plan right below this memo.

confidential, kagep-kahof: Druokax Systems plans to lower the Ulaath list price by 53 percent in March.

## Changelog — Ticktrace 1.9

### Renamed: DRIFT_API_TOKEN
During the cron drift investigation we found plugins confusing this variable with the metrics token, so it has been renamed to indicate it authorizes drift-report uploads specifically. Plugin authors must read the new name from 1.9 onward; the old name is ignored without warning. Sample env files in the SDK are updated. In your deployment env file, the drift-report upload secret is set on the next line.

env line for fawef-taguf: VAULT_KEY13=a9695905a9a90

Ticket: Staging env misconfigured for Siftgate bloom filter

The bloom layer in front of the Pellet KV store is rejecting all lookups in staging because the env file was copied from the dev template without credentials. False-positive tuning values are fine; only the auth line is missing. To unblock the weekly demo, the Pellet admission secret must be set on the following line.

env line for yaguf-fajop: LEDGER_TOKEN13=fb08984397349